对象存储 开源数据库,深入探讨开源对象存储数据库,技术特点、应用场景与未来展望
- 综合资讯
- 2024-11-10 05:56:59
- 1

开源对象存储数据库技术特点鲜明,涵盖高效存储、灵活扩展等。广泛应用于云存储、大数据等领域。随着技术创新,其应用场景将不断拓展,前景广阔。...
开源对象存储数据库技术特点鲜明,涵盖高效存储、灵活扩展等。广泛应用于云存储、大数据等领域。随着技术创新,其应用场景将不断拓展,前景广阔。
随着互联网技术的飞速发展,数据存储需求日益增长,传统的文件系统、关系型数据库等存储方式已无法满足海量数据存储和高效访问的需求,近年来,对象存储技术逐渐崭露头角,成为大数据、云计算等领域的重要存储解决方案,本文将围绕开源对象存储数据库展开,分析其技术特点、应用场景及未来发展趋势。
开源对象存储数据库概述
1、定义
开源对象存储数据库是一种基于对象存储架构的开源数据库,它将数据以对象的形式存储,对象由元数据、数据本身以及一个唯一的标识符组成,用户可以通过HTTP协议对存储在数据库中的对象进行操作。
2、代表性开源对象存储数据库
(1)Ceph:Ceph是一款分布式存储系统,支持对象存储、块存储和文件存储,它具有高可靠性、高性能、可扩展性等特点,广泛应用于云存储、大数据等领域。
(2)GlusterFS:GlusterFS是一款分布式文件系统,支持对象存储,它具有高可靠性、高性能、可扩展性等特点,适用于大规模数据存储场景。
(3)MinIO:MinIO是一款开源的S3兼容对象存储系统,具有高性能、高可用性、易于部署等特点,它支持多种存储引擎,包括本地存储、Ceph、GlusterFS等。
开源对象存储数据库技术特点
1、分布式存储
开源对象存储数据库采用分布式存储架构,将数据分散存储在多个节点上,提高数据可靠性、可扩展性和高性能。
2、高可靠性
开源对象存储数据库通过数据冗余、故障转移等技术,确保数据在存储过程中不会丢失。
3、高性能
开源对象存储数据库采用多线程、异步IO等技术,提高数据读写速度,满足高性能需求。
4、可扩展性
开源对象存储数据库支持横向扩展,通过增加节点提高存储容量和性能。
5、兼容性
开源对象存储数据库支持多种协议,如S3、Swift等,方便与其他系统对接。
6、开源特性
开源对象存储数据库具有开源特性,用户可以自由修改、扩展和优化。
开源对象存储数据库应用场景
1、云计算平台
开源对象存储数据库在云计算平台中扮演重要角色,为虚拟机、容器等提供数据存储服务。
2、大数据应用
开源对象存储数据库在大数据领域具有广泛的应用,如数据采集、处理、存储和分析等。
3、媒体行业
开源对象存储数据库在媒体行业中用于存储大量的视频、音频、图片等媒体资源。
4、互联网应用
开源对象存储数据库在互联网应用中用于存储用户数据、文件等。
未来展望
1、技术创新
随着技术的发展,开源对象存储数据库将在性能、可靠性、可扩展性等方面持续创新,以满足日益增长的数据存储需求。
2、行业应用
开源对象存储数据库将在更多领域得到应用,如金融、医疗、教育等。
3、开源生态
开源对象存储数据库将继续完善开源生态,吸引更多开发者参与,推动技术发展。
4、商业化
部分开源对象存储数据库项目将逐步实现商业化,提供更完善的解决方案和服务。
开源对象存储数据库作为一种新兴的存储技术,具有广泛的应用前景,本文对开源对象存储数据库进行了概述,分析了其技术特点、应用场景及未来发展趋势,随着技术的不断进步,开源对象存储数据库将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/725194.html
发表评论